大家好,我是热爱开源的了不起!
随着互联网技术的飞速发展,服务器已经成为现代社会不可或缺的基础设施。
为了保障服务器的稳定运行,我们需要对服务器进行有效的监控。传统的服务器监控工具往往功能复杂,配置繁琐,不太友好。
今天了不起给大家介绍一个高颜值的开源项目-
Dashdot
,简洁好用,非常适合于小型VPS和个人服务器。
项目简介
Dashdot
是一款开源的服务器监控工具,旨在为用户提供简洁易用、功能强大的监控体验。Dashdot 采用 TypeScript 语言开发,可以监控服务器的 CPU、内存、磁盘、网络等多种指标。
项目安装
官方建议用docker进行安装
docker container run -it \
-p 80:3001 \
-v /:/mnt/host:ro \
--privileged \
mauricenino/dashdot
当然,如果有一些自定义的参数设置,可以使用下面的代码:
docker container run -it \
--env DASHDOT_ENABLE_CPU_TEMPS="true" \ # ...
更多安装详细信息,可以看官方文档
https://github.com/MauriceNino/dashdot
项目展示
安装好之后,页面如下图,界面非常的漂亮,数据都是以实时动态图形化的模块界面展示,很直观。
默认情况下,Dashdot 会自动显示识别出CPU,内存,硬盘,网络等信息。
支持暗黑主题
上面这个是默认安装时候的样式。当然可以在这个基础上面进行一些个性化设置。
官方提供的个性化设置变量非常多,如更改面板显示的模块,显示CPU的温度,温度显示模式,显示storage的标签内容,显示余量百分比等。
更多的设置,可以查看官方提供的设置文档:
https://getdashdot.com/docs/configuration
如果小伙伴们也在找一款轻量、美观且易用的监控面板,了不起推荐你试试 Dashdot。
更多项目细节功能,自行去项目地址探索~~
github地址:https://github.com/MauriceNino/dashdot
写在最后
加我微信,发送暗号 「程序员副业」 ,送一份我整理的高价值资料~
无套路,免费领~
我是了不起,感谢各位童鞋的:点赞、收藏和在看,我们下期更精彩!